Q: How do you find the number of side in a polygon if all you know is the sum of exterior angles?

How many sides does a polygon have if the measure of each exterior angle of a regular polygon is 45 degrees?

8 Since the sum of the exterior angles of any polygon is always 360, you can divide 360 by 45 to find the number of exterior angles, which is 8. That means 8 interior angles and eight sides as well.
